Which of the following statements about prokaryotic cells is correct?
A
Prokaryotes have ribosomes, but they are smaller than those in eukaryotes.
B
Prokaryotes have membrane-bound ribosomes.
C
Prokaryotes do not have ribosomes.
D
Prokaryotes only have ribosomes when they are dividing.

Understand the structure of prokaryotic cells: Prokaryotic cells are simpler than eukaryotic cells and lack membrane-bound organelles, such as the nucleus and mitochondria. However, they do contain ribosomes, which are essential for protein synthesis.
Clarify the nature of ribosomes in prokaryotes: Ribosomes in prokaryotic cells are smaller than those found in eukaryotic cells. Specifically, prokaryotic ribosomes are 70S in size, while eukaryotic ribosomes are 80S. The 'S' refers to Svedberg units, a measure of sedimentation rate during centrifugation.
Evaluate the statement 'Prokaryotes have membrane-bound ribosomes': This is incorrect because prokaryotic ribosomes are free-floating in the cytoplasm and are not attached to any membranes, unlike eukaryotic ribosomes, which can be bound to the endoplasmic reticulum.
Assess the statement 'Prokaryotes do not have ribosomes': This is incorrect because ribosomes are present in all prokaryotic cells and are vital for translating mRNA into proteins.
Analyze the statement 'Prokaryotes only have ribosomes when they are dividing': This is incorrect because ribosomes are always present in prokaryotic cells, regardless of whether the cell is dividing or not. Protein synthesis is a continuous process necessary for cell function and survival.
